Teams

The following 28 teams, split into two regions (West Region and East Region), entered the qualifying play-offs, consisting of three rounds: *8 teams entered in the preliminary round 1. *12 teams entered in the preliminary round 2. *8 teams entered in the play-off round.

Bracket

The bracket of the qualifying play-offs for each region was determined based on the association ranking of each team, with the team from the higher-ranked association hosting the match. Teams from the same association could not be placed into the same tie. The eight winners of the play-off round (four each from both West Region and East Region) advanced to the

Preliminary round 2


Summary

A total of 16 teams played in the preliminary round 2: twelve teams which entered in this round, and the four winners of the preliminary round 1.

Play-off round


Summary

A total of 16 teams played in the play-off round: eight teams which entered in this round, and the eight winners of the preliminary round 2.
